Transaction ef07dcf9903d995d24a0bca909dd252f164f441defe203026eedc5167285bfb0
1 Input
1 Output
-
ef07dcf9903d995d24a0bca909dd252f164f441defe203026eedc5167285bfb0:0
- value
- 233158
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0472051908838a6c87400fcdb87d34a36454a298 OP_EQUAL
- address
- 326XDZ4LYH68gQAd1hs9hByDGqdbnD6YaX